Focusing initially however on the top four race, Manchester United’s draw with Burnley means that Arsenal sit three points ahead of the Gunners having played two games more.
Arsenal have one of their rescheduled games in a couple of weeks’ time at home to Wolves who they face tomorrow at Molineux. The other postponed fixture awaiting a confirmed date is the north London derby in the Tottenham Hotspur stadium.
Win both games and the Gunners will open a three-point lead on their top-four opponents. United need to travel to the Emirates before the season’s close giving Mikel Arteta’s side another opportunity to further their advantage.
